A thoughtful option for travelers arriving in Hanoi early in the morning, when hotel check-in is not yet available but you don’t want to spend the time waiting idly.
The experience begins with a short rest, followed by a relaxed breakfast and coffee in a quiet setting, before a gentle walk through the Old Quarter with stories about Hanoi’s everyday life and culture.
Ideal for those who prefer to start the day slowly, comfortably, and with a more meaningful introduction to the city.

The Hanoi Social Club is one of the city’s most charming hidden gems, tucked away in a quiet corner of the Old Quarter. Set inside a beautifully aged French colonial villa, the café offers a warm, vintage atmosphere with mismatched furniture, leafy balconies, and cozy nooks that invite guests to slow down and relax.
A cup of freshly brewed coffee paired with a simple breakfast—like toast, eggs, or a healthy bowl—makes for a slow, mindful start to the day. The vibe is relaxed and slightly artistic, so it’s also a great spot to read a book, journal, or just sit and watch life go by.
Wander through the narrow streets of Hanoi’s Old Quarter as your guide brings the city to life through stories of history, culture, and everyday local life. From ancient guild streets to hidden corners, each step reveals a different layer of Hanoi that most visitors never see.
